For owners seeking a replacement, <a href=\"https:\/\/www.fs1inc.com\/chrysler-dodge-plymouth\/mitsubishi-pcm-ecm-ecu-engine-computer\/endeavor-engine-computers.html\">2010 Mitsubishi Endeavor replacement modules<\/a> are available that match the original specifications and fit within the vehicle&#8217;s electronic architecture.<\/p>\n<\/div>\n<div class=\"info-section\">\n<h2>Where the PCM Is Located and What Replacement Involves<\/h2>\n<p>Both the PCM and the ECM are mounted within the engine compartment of the 2010 Mitsubishi Endeavor, typically attached to the firewall near the intake manifold. Removal involves disconnecting the electrical harness, unbolting the unit and extracting it from its bracket. Reinstallation follows the reverse order, with torque specifications applied as per the service manual. The book time for a complete Powertrain Control Module removal and replacement is listed as 0.5 hours, while the Engine Control Module removal and replacement also requires 0.5 hours. After the hardware is secured, an Engine Control Module relearn procedure adds another 0.5 hour to the total labor estimate.<\/p>\n<figure style=\"margin:22px auto;text-align:center;max-width:720px\"><img decoding=\"async\" style=\"max-width:100%;height:auto;border:1px solid #e2e6ec;border-radius:8px\" src=\"https:\/\/www.fs1inc.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/07\/2010-mitsubishi-endeavor-pcm-location-diagram.webp\" alt=\"2010 Mitsubishi Endeavor PCM location diagram\" loading=\"lazy\"\/><figcaption style=\"font-size:13px;color:#667085;margin-top:8px\">PCM mounting location on the 2010 Mitsubishi Endeavor.<\/figcaption><\/figure>\n<div style=\"background:#f7f9fc;border:1px solid #e2e8f2;border-radius:10px;padding:18px 24px;margin:18px 0\">\n<h3 style='margin-top:0'>How to Reach the PCM on the 2010 Mitsubishi Endeavor<\/h3>\n<ol style=\"margin:14px 0 6px 0;padding-left:26px\">\n<li style=\"margin:10px 0;line-height:1.65\"><b>Remove<\/b> the PCM connector cover.<\/li>\n<li style=\"margin:10px 0;line-height:1.65\"><b>Remove<\/b> the PCM bracket.<\/li>\n<li style=\"margin:10px 0;line-height:1.65\"><b>Remove<\/b> the PCM connectors.<\/li>\n<li style=\"margin:10px 0;line-height:1.65\"><b>Remove<\/b> the break-off bolts.<\/li>\n<\/ol>\n<p style='margin:10px 0 0 0'><em>Work with the ignition off, and treat the module as static-sensitive: avoid touching the connector pins at any point.<\/em><\/p>\n<\/div>\n<table style=\"width:100%;border-collapse:collapse;margin:18px 0;font-size:15px\">\n<tr>\n<th style=\"border:1px solid #d6dbe3;background:#f2f5f9;padding:9px 12px;text-align:left\">Operation<\/th>\n<th style=\"border:1px solid #d6dbe3;background:#f2f5f9;padding:9px 12px;text-align:left\">Configuration<\/th>\n<th style=\"border:1px solid #d6dbe3;background:#f2f5f9;padding:9px 12px;text-align:left\">Book Time<\/th>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td style=\"border:1px solid #d6dbe3;padding:9px 12px\">Powertrain Control Module R&amp;R<\/td>\n<td style=\"border:1px solid #d6dbe3;padding:9px 12px\">All configurations<\/td>\n<td style=\"border:1px solid #d6dbe3;padding:9px 12px\">0.5 hr<\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td style=\"border:1px solid #d6dbe3;padding:9px 12px\">Engine Control Module Relearn<\/td>\n<td style=\"border:1px solid #d6dbe3;padding:9px 12px\">All configurations<\/td>\n<td style=\"border:1px solid #d6dbe3;padding:9px 12px\">0.5 hr<\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td style=\"border:1px solid #d6dbe3;padding:9px 12px\">Engine Control Module R&amp;R<\/td>\n<td style=\"border:1px solid #d6dbe3;padding:9px 12px\">All configurations<\/td>\n<td style=\"border:1px solid #d6dbe3;padding:9px 12px\">0.5 hr<\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<\/table>\n<\/div>\n<div class=\"info-section\">\n<h2>Programming Requirements After Replacement<\/h2>\n<p>Once the PCM or ECM is physically installed, the factory service routine calls for a relearn of the Engine Control Module to synchronize sensor calibrations and adaptation values. Flagship One provides <a href=\"https:\/\/www.fs1inc.com\/2010-mitsubishi-endeavor-3-8l-pcm-engine-computer-ecm-ecu-programmed-plug-play.html\">a VIN\u2011programmed replacement unit<\/a> that arrives already coded to match your vehicle&#8217;s unique identifiers, so the relearn process is completed at the factory and does not need to be performed on the shop floor.<\/p>\n<\/div>\n<div class=\"info-section\">\n<h2>Symptoms of a Failing PCM<\/h2>\n<p>A failing PCM or ECM in the 2010 Mitsubishi Endeavor may present as a complete lack of engine cranking, intermittent stalling at idle, rough acceleration, or the illumination of the check engine light. Drivers often notice a loss of power during acceleration or unexpected gear shifts if the transmission control signals are compromised. Diagnostic scans frequently reveal internal fault codes; for example, the presence of <a href=\"https:\/\/www.fs1inc.com\/blog\/dtc-p0606-control-module-processor\/\">PCM internal memory error<\/a> indicates a problem within the module&#8217;s internal circuitry. Communication loss between the scan tool and the vehicle&#8217;s computer network is another hallmark of a defective control unit.<\/p>\n<\/div>\n<div class=\"info-section\">\n<h2>Module Trouble Codes on the 2010 Mitsubishi Endeavor<\/h2>\n<p>The following internal diagnostic trouble codes have been recorded for the 2010 Mitsubishi Endeavor&#8217;s control modules:<\/p>\n<table style=\"width:100%;border-collapse:collapse;margin:18px 0;font-size:15px\">\n<tr>\n<th style=\"border:1px solid #d6dbe3;background:#f2f5f9;padding:9px 12px;text-align:left\">Code<\/th>\n<th style=\"border:1px solid #d6dbe3;background:#f2f5f9;padding:9px 12px;text-align:left\">Meaning<\/th>\n<th style=\"border:1px solid #d6dbe3;background:#f2f5f9;padding:9px 12px;text-align:left\">Full Guide<\/th>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td style=\"border:1px solid #d6dbe3;padding:9px 12px\"><a href=\"https:\/\/www.fs1inc.com\/blog\/dtc-p0606-control-module-processor\/\" style=\"color:#0563C1;text-decoration:none;display:block;cursor:pointer\"><b>P0606<\/b><\/a><\/td>\n<td style=\"border:1px solid #d6dbe3;padding:9px 12px\"><a href=\"https:\/\/www.fs1inc.com\/blog\/dtc-p0606-control-module-processor\/\" style=\"color:#1a2b49;text-decoration:none;display:block;cursor:pointer\">Module processor failure<\/a><\/td>\n<td style=\"border:1px solid #d6dbe3;padding:9px 12px\"><a href=\"https:\/\/www.fs1inc.com\/blog\/dtc-p0606-control-module-processor\/\" style=\"color:#0563C1\"><b><u>Full P0606 guide &rarr;<\/u><\/b><\/a><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<\/table>\n<\/div>\n<div class=\"info-section\">\n<h2>Protecting the PCM in Your 2010 Mitsubishi Endeavor<\/h2>\n<ul style=\"margin:14px 0 6px 0;padding-left:26px\">\n<li style=\"margin:10px 0;line-height:1.65\">Maintain a healthy charging system to avoid voltage fluctuations that can corrupt module memory.<\/li>\n<li style=\"margin:10px 0;line-height:1.65\">Inspect and clean all ground connections and connector pins regularly.<\/li>\n<li style=\"margin:10px 0;line-height:1.65\">Avoid jump\u2011starting the vehicle with excessive voltage spikes.<\/li>\n<li style=\"margin:10px 0;line-height:1.65\">Address any stored trouble codes promptly to prevent module overload.<\/li>\n<li style=\"margin:10px 0;line-height:1.65\">Keep connector seals intact to protect against moisture intrusion.<\/li>\n<li style=\"margin:10px 0;line-height:1.65\">Schedule periodic software updates when recommended by the manufacturer.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<\/div>\n<div class=\"info-section\">\n<h2>Frequently Asked Questions<\/h2>\n<h3>What are the common signs that the PCM needs replacement on a 2010 Mitsubishi Endeavor?<\/h3>\n<p>Typical indicators include a no\u2011start condition, erratic idle, loss of power during acceleration, and the check engine light flashing with codes related to PCM internal errors.<\/p>\n<h3>Can I replace both the PCM and the ETACS\u2011ECU at the same time on a 2010 Mitsubishi Endeavor?<\/h3>\n<p>Factory guidance advises against simultaneous replacement; you should replace one unit first and complete the encrypted code registration before addressing the other.<\/p>\n<h3>How long will a certified shop need to install a new PCM in my Endeavor?<\/h3>\n<p>The labor estimate for a Powertrain Control Module removal and installation is approximately 0.5 hour, plus an additional 0.5 hour for the Engine Control Module relearn if required.<\/p>\n<h3>Do Flagship One replacement modules require any programming after installation?<\/h3>\n<p>Flagship One units arrive VIN\u2011programmed, which means the factory\u2011required coding and relearn steps are already completed, eliminating on\u2011site programming.<\/p>\n<h3>What should I do if the check engine light stays on after replacing the PCM?<\/h3>\n<p>Verify that the encrypted code registration was performed correctly and clear any remaining codes with a scan tool; if the light persists, further diagnosis may be needed.<\/p>\n<\/div>\n<div class=\"info-section\">\n<p>When the PCM or ECM in your 2010 Mitsubishi Endeavor shows signs of failure, you can choose a factory\u2011repaired unit or a refurbished replacement from Flagship One.
